Output 6d3144e975993e1ad9263faf43720d7c7c76f27fc15d4ad1102f31fdf2153eb5:2

value
15012691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a46cc18700db2930b7da0065f0d55d564b54d7b OP_EQUAL
address
MDDJEdoeYxFjz45nv8LTT6FdphhKT8t6oC
transaction
6d3144e975993e1ad9263faf43720d7c7c76f27fc15d4ad1102f31fdf2153eb5
spent
true